Emmitt Smith Not only is Smith arguably one of the greatest players in Cowboys history, but hes also arguably the best running back in NFL history. Smith was ranked No. 1 in FOX Sports top-10 running backs list, as no running back has ever rushed for more yards (18,355) and touchdowns (164).

1. Roger Staubach. Earning several nicknames like Roger The Dodger and Captain America, Roger Staubachs greatness helped the Cowboys become the nations favorite team. He led them to four Super Bowl appearances and won two of them, most notably winning MVP in Super Bowl VI in 1971.
Larry Christopher Allen Jr. He played college football for the Butte Roadrunners and the Sonoma State Cossacks, and was selected by the Cowboys in the second round of the 1994 NFL draft. A player capable of using his speed against defenders, Allen was regarded as one of the strongest players to ever play in the NFL.
